Thursdays, 12:30-1:15pm we host our weekly advocacy sessions via Zoom. Welcoming stalwarts as well as newcomers we will provide information and support to anyone interested in participating in vital political and social justice work around the key issues we face as Americans and as progressive Jews. We\u2019ll help you make your voice heard by contacting elected officials and key figures in city, state and federal government through texting, emailing, calling and sending letters and postcards. <\/p>
<\/p>
Some areas we work on: Voter protection\/access\/registration\/turnout. Immigration. Refugee protections. Protecting the Environment. Common sense gun laws. Ending mass incarceration. Education reform. Healthcare. The fight against rising antisemitism and racism and bigotry in all forms.<\/p>

Mishpachah is a CBST social and cultural group, diverse in its membership and informal in nature, attracting those over the age of 55 while welcoming all for a truly inter-generational experience. The group's goals are building friendship, fun, networking and mutual support. <\/span>Join us on Zoom!<\/a><\/p>","registration":null},"701PK00000nUu0mYAC":{"name":"Multifaith Mondays","date":"August 10, 2026, 5:30 pm - 6:30 pm","description":"Multifaith Mondays: Moral Witness for Democracy - Weekly Vigil
